About Raleigh Egypt Middle School

Raleigh Egypt Middle School is a public middle school in Memphis, TN, part of Memphis-Shelby County Schools. Raleigh Egypt Middle School serves approximately 488 students, and covers grades 6th-8th, and has a 21.2:1 student-teacher ratio. Raleigh Egypt Middle School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.7 out of 10 and ranks #1,177 of 1,786 schools in TN.

Structured state assessment records for Raleigh Egypt Middle School show 4%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2020-2025) and 7%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2020-2025).

What Parents Should Know

Test scores at Raleigh Egypt Middle School sit below average, but its growth scores are strong: students here make above-average progress year over year. The raw numbers haven't caught up, but a school that keeps moving kids forward is doing the harder, more important work.

Raleigh Egypt Middle School runs 21.2:1 students to teachers, above the national average. That often means bigger classes. Ask how the school supports kids who need extra help, and whether there are teaching assistants or small-group time.
